Wingeier, a junior forward from Newark, played basketball and volleyball for the Newark Lady 'Cats, notching 103 kills and 75 total blocks, including 52 solo denials, as a senior in 2016. She helped lead Newark to two OHSAA Division I Final Four appearances in a three-span span between her sophomore and senior years, with the Lady 'Cats obtaining OHSAA Division I Final Four appearances in 2014-15 and 2016-17. Wingeier helped lead Newark to a 95-14 overall record over her four seasons inside the program.
At Shawnee State, Wingeier's served Shawnee State well as a change-of-pace post player who can create matchup problems in the halfcourt with her size. She was an Academic All-MSC recipient last year as a sophomore.
